IGF-1在不同鸡与鹌鹑杂交禽胚胎肌肉发育过程中的表达规律与差异

摘    要:【目的】研究IGF-1基因在蛋用型种鸡(♂)×鹌鹑(♀)和肉用型种鸡(♂)×鹌鹑(♀)两种不同杂交禽胚胎肌肉发育过程中的表达规律,比较该基因在两种不同杂交禽中的差异表达,探讨IGF-1基因在肌肉发育网络调控中的作用。【方法】通过人工受精的方法,蛋用型种鸡(♂)×鹌鹑(♀)获得蛋杂交禽蛋、肉用型种鸡(♂)×鹌鹑(♀)获得肉杂交禽蛋,与鸡蛋、鹌鹑蛋按照鸡标准孵化条件同批人孵,采集第7~17 d活胚胸肌组织,应用实时荧光定量PCR技术检测IGF-1基因在四个物种中每个时间点mRNA的相对表达量。【结果】IGF-1基因在胚胎肌肉发育的第7~17 d均有表达,在第10 d达到第一次峰值,鸡和鹌鹑在第16 d达到第二次峰值,蛋杂交禽和肉杂交禽在第15 d达到峰值。【结论】IGF-1可能在胚胎肌肉的生长发育过程中起调控作用;IGF-1 mRNA表达规律与成肌细胞增殖和肌管融合规律一致,可能参与调控成肌细胞的增殖和肌管的融合。

Developmental Expressional Profiles of IGF-1 during Embryonic Myogenesis in Two Strains of Hybrid of Chicken - Quail

Abstract:Objective]The purpose of this study was to analyze IGF - 1 mRNA expression profiles and differences during embryonic myogenesis in two strains of hybrid of chicken - quail,and evaluate the potential relationships between IGF - 1 expression and myogenesis.Method]Two strains of cross -bred eggs of quail ($ ) were acquired by artificial insemination by chicken(6 ) - semen,with the eggs of chicken,quail and hybrid in one batch hatched according to the standard condition of chicken,and then the breast muscle tissues from day 7 to day 17 were collected.The expression of IGF - 1 mRNA in different species every day was revealed by real - time quantitative PCR.Result]The expression of IGF - 1 mRNA was detected from day 7 to day 17.The first peak time of IGF - 1 expression was noticed at day 10 in four species,the second peak time was noticed at day 16 in Chicken and Quail,and at day 15 in Meat - Hybrid and Egg - Hybrid. Conclusion]IGF - 1 maybe plays a key role in the process of myogenesis.The expression profile of IGF - 1 was in accord with the profile of myoblasts proliferation and muscle tube fusion,and it maybe plays a key role in the process of myoblasts proliferation and muscle tube fusion.
